Drafts (Formerly Configurations)
The Drafts page lists all draft configurations that have been started but not yet fully submitted as a quotation request.
A configuration contains only the configuration data (the selected options and settings from the configurator), but does not include the completed request fields such as customer details or contact information.
Because of this, configurations are considered drafts — they can be resumed, edited, or eventually submitted to become a Quote.
This page is primarily used to manage, review, and reopen draft configurations.

Table Columns
The default table contains the following columns:
| Column | Description |
|---|---|
| # | Unique configuration ID. |
| User | The user who created the draft configuration. |
| Name | The name given to the configuration project. |
| Updated | Date and time when the configuration was last updated. |
| Created | Date and time when the configuration was originally created. |
| Actions | Quick tools to manage the configuration (see full details below). |
Actions
Each row in the Actions column includes the following options:
- Open Configuration – Reopens the draft configuration in the frontend configurator so you can continue working on it.
- Preview – Displays the configuration in a read-only mode to see what has been selected so far.
- Edit – Opens the configuration in edit mode for making changes.
- Delete – Permanently removes the configuration from the system.
